Output e530afd5834aa8dbe95c8a860aae5d1983b428b357690bab7d347ea0e0d88f3e:0

value
158000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8dc6821d5d6537de84a6e38f31685b7b87d640a2 OP_EQUAL
address
3Ecf1BqJKKPQN1QFWYXgg3oSWWJfUAgF7k
transaction
e530afd5834aa8dbe95c8a860aae5d1983b428b357690bab7d347ea0e0d88f3e
confirmations
170486
spent
true